Foraging in Whatcom County

Abe Lloyd, a senior professor at Western who studies native plants, biodiversity and Northwest Coast ethnobotany, said the PNW is a great place for foraging.

 

Due to the large elevation gradient between the Pacific Ocean and Cascade Mountain Range, the diversity and chance of finding edible plants is high.

 

“For every 1,000 feet there's a different community,” Lloyd said. “There’s all sorts of variability like uplands, wetlands, slope face and more.”
